1. A system for providing ablation guidance, comprising:
a display, which is configured to display at least a three-dimensional (3D) anatomical map of an organ having tissue comprising first and second surfaces that are facing one another; and
an ablation catheter for forming a first lesion on the tissue, by applying ablation signals to the first surface of the tissue;
a processor, which is configured to:
receive a first position of the first lesion formed by the ablation catheter ablating the first surface;
calculate, on the second surface, a second position that is facing the first position by: (a) selecting two or more locations on the second surface, (b) calculating two or more distances, respectively, between: (i) the first position and (ii) each of the two or more locations, and (iii) selecting the second position from among the two or more locations, based on a shortest distance selected among the two or more distances;
determine the calculated second position to be a position for a marker, based on the selected shortest distance; and
display, over the 3D anatomical map, the marker indicative of the second position, for guiding a user to produce on the second surface of the tissue a second lesion facing the first lesion by applying ablation signals to the second surface of the tissue.
